If you had a Tubal Ligation you have two options to achieve pregnancy:
Tubal Reversal and/or In-Vitro Fertilization.
On average, an IVF cycle will cost you $12,000 with an average success rate under 22% per attempt. If your first IVF cycle is not successul, you will need to pay another $12,000. If you want another child via IVF, you will need to pay $12,000 per attempt again. For those who are otherwise fertile but have had tubal ligation sterilization,
we believe our technique of laparoscopic tubal reversal should be
the preferred treatment. Our technique:
• avoids the possible complications from drugs used in IVF
• reduces the risk of complications due to multiple pregnancies
• costs only $10,000, generally less than even one IVF cycle (let alone multiple cycles if, as is likely, the first IVF cycle is unsuccessful)
• provides success rates as high as 79% if
you are 35 or younger
Multiple births are another risk with IVF. IVF requires visits for ultrasound to monitor egg production, a visit to retrieve the egg(s), and a visit to put the fertilized embryo back into your womb. If you have a job, you will need an understanding boss. If you are a stay-at-home mom, you will need childcare. The time committment with IVF is enormous, the risks are high, and the expense for one attempt is enormous.
